How much do building man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 19, 2026, the average yearly pay for building manager in Surrey, BC is $51,498.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$37,542.00 and $61,569.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a building manager?

A building manager is in charge of the property management for a building. You often work in schools, hospitals, retail buildings, or apartment complexes. It is your job to ensure the safety and security of the building and its occupants. Your main duties involve maintaining building cleanliness, overseeing security and emergency systems, and scheduling maintenance and repairs. You manage other employees by assigning them daily tasks and overseeing their work. Your exact duties as a building manager vary depending upon the building at which you are employed.

What does a building manager do?

Building managers are responsible for overseeing the daily operations, maintenance, and safety of residential, commercial, or industrial buildings. Their duties typically include coordinating repairs, managing tenant requests, supervising staff, conducting inspections, and ensuring compliance with safety and building regulations. Building managers play a vital role in keeping properties functional, safe, and well-maintained for occupants and visitors.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a building man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Building Manager, you need strong knowledge of facility operations, maintenance procedures, and regulatory compliance, often supported by a background in property management or a related field. Familiarity with building management systems (BMS), maintenance scheduling software, and relevant safety certifications like OSHA are typically required. Excellent problem-solving, communication, and organizational skills help manage tenant relationships and coordinate with contractors effectively. These skills ensure safe, efficient building operations and high tenant satisfaction, which are critical for the property's success.

What are some typical challenges a building manager faces in coordinating maintenance and repairs?

Building Managers often encounter challenges in balancing urgent repair requests with routine maintenance schedules, particularly in larger or older properties. Coordinating with multiple vendors, ensuring minimal disruption to tenants, and staying within budget constraints can be demanding. Effective communication with occupants and maintenance teams, as well as proactive planning, are key to managing these responsibilities smoothly. Staying organized and anticipating issues before they escalate helps ensure building operations run efficiently.

Is building management a stressful job?

Building management can be stressful due to the need to handle maintenance issues, tenant concerns, and safety regulations, often requiring quick decision-making and multitasking. The role involves managing emergencies, coordinating repairs, and ensuring compliance, which can contribute to job stress levels.

Building Science Project Manager

Group: Building Envelope Services (BES)
Location: Canada
Employment Type: Full-Time

Overview

Rimkus is seeking a motivated and experienced Building Science Project Manager to join our Building Envelope Services team. In this role, you will be responsible for managing a variety of building science and building envelope projects from investigation through completion. Your work will include field investigations, condition assessments, report preparation, design development, contract administration, quality observation, and client management.

The ideal candidate is technically strong, highly organized, and capable of managing multiple projects simultaneously while building and maintaining strong relationships with clients, contractors, consultants, and manufacturers.

ResponsibilitiesProject Management & Technical Services
  • Manage multiple building science and building envelope projects concurrently.
  • Perform field reviews, testing, investigations, and data collection.
  • Conduct condition assessments, failure investigations, diagnosis, and remediation evaluations.
  • Prepare technical reports, specifications, and supporting documentation.
  • Complete design assignments of varying scope and complexity.
  • Apply technical methods and engineering principles to solve project-specific challenges.
  • Ensure accuracy of calculations, data collection, analyses, and technical documentation.
  • Measure building dimensions and quantify materials both on-site and from drawings.
Design & Documentation
  • Prepare and review project drawings, specifications, and technical documents.
  • Utilize AutoCAD to support project design and documentation requirements.
  • Review contractor submittals and shop drawings for compliance with project requirements.
  • Review drawings and specifications prepared by others to verify adequacy of scope, materials, methods, and details.
Construction Administration & Quality Assurance
  • Oversee field reviews, testing programs, and project inspections.
  • Perform quality observations to verify compliance with contract documents, applicable building codes, and industry standards.
  • Coordinate and conduct pre-bid, pre-construction, progress, and project closeout meetings.
  • Provide contract administration services throughout project execution.
Team & Client Collaboration
  • Act as the primary liaison between clients, contractors, manufacturers, and project stakeholders.
  • Provide technical guidance and support to field technicians and technologists.
  • Assist with project planning, scheduling, budgeting, and resource allocation.
  • Coordinate project billing inputs and job costing information.
  • Perform other related duties as assigned.
Required Skills & Abilities
  • Proficiency in AutoCAD and the Microsoft Office Suite.
  • Strong technical writing, verbal communication, and presentation skills.
  • Exceptional attention to detail, particularly regarding technical accuracy and completeness of documentation.
  • Ability to work independently while collaborating effectively within a multidisciplinary team.
  • Strong organizational and time-management sk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ities.
  • Demonstrated flexibility and adaptability in a fast-paced consulting environment.
  • Self-motivated with the ability to take initiative and solve problems proactively.
  • High level of professionalism, integrity, and commitment to quality service.
Qualifications
  • Degree or diploma in Engineering or Engineering Technology with a focus in:
    • Building Science
    • Architectural Engineering
    • Civil Engineering
    • Structural Engineering
    • Mechanical Engineering
    • Related discipline
  • Registered, or eligible for registration, as an Engineer-in-Training (EIT) or Professional Engineer (P.Eng.) with the applicable provincial regulatory body.
  • Professional designations related to building science, building envelope consulting, or engineering are considered an asset.
  • Minimum 5+ years of project coordination, project management, or consulting experience within building science, building envelope, engineering, or a related industry.
